Turquoise-browed Motmot Eumomota superciliosa

Described by: Sandbach (1837)

Range

C. Central America. Yucatan.
Two populations;
(1) S. Mexico on the Pacific slope from Chiapas to w. Guatemala.
(2) Se. Mexico on the Caribbean slope from s. Veracruz and Tabasco to the Yucatan Peninsula.
(3) C. Guatemala.
(4) E. Guatemala.
(5) El Salvador, w. Honduras and nw. Nicaragua.
(6) N. Honduras.
(7) Nw. Costa Rica.
